Does Ford have ADAS?
Yes, Ford does offer adv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) on many of its vehicles. ADAS are a suite of technologies that can help enhance safety and provide driver assistance features.
What is ADAS?
ADAS, or advanced driver assistance systems, are a collection of technologies that use sensors, cameras, and other systems to monitor the driving environment and provide features to assist the driver. These can include things like automatic emergency braking, lane-keeping assist, adaptive cruise control, and more. ADAS are designed to help improve safety and make driving easier and more convenient.
Ford's ADAS Offerings
Ford has been integrating ADAS features into its vehicles for several years. Some of the key ADAS technologies available on Ford models include:
- Pre-Collision Assist with Automatic Emergency Braking
- Lane-Keeping System
- Adaptive Cruise Control
- Blind Spot Information System
- Rear View Camera
- Reverse Brake Assist
- Evasive Steering Assist
These ADAS features are available on many Ford models, including the F-150, Mustang Mach-E, Explorer, and Escape, among others. The specific ADAS features offered can vary by model and trim level.

How much is a Ford BlueCruise subscription?
At the end of the initial complimentary trial or included plan duration, customers can choose to purchase a monthly subscription for $49.99 or an annual subscription for $495.

Who is leading ADAS?
Leading Suppliers Will Double ADAS Revenues to €35 Billion by 2025. The Top-4 Automotive Suppliers of ADAS are all European, Bosch, Valeo, ZF and Continental, according to Auto2x's Global Supplier Ranking by ADAS Revenues. “ZF and Continental broke the €2 Billion mark in ADAS revenues in 2022, but challenges persist”.

What year did Ford put adaptive cruise control?
Vehicle models supporting adaptive cruise control
Make | Full speed range ACC |
---|---|
Models | |
Dodge | Charger (2015+), Challenger (2015+) |
Ford | Everest (2015+, Trend and Titanium models only), Fusion (2017+), F-150 (2018+), Expedition (2018+), Mustang (2015+, Premium models only), Focus (2018+) |

Is the Ford Co-Pilot360 the same as Blue Cruise?
What's the difference between BlueCruise and Ford-CoPilot360 ® Technology? Ford Co-Pilot360 Technology is a suite of available Advanced Driver Assistance Features to help keep you in command of your vehicle. BlueCruise builds on these technologies to provide hands-free highway driving capability.
